'Blackberry' data is included in your tariff, (subject to fair use policy!) - includes email, web-browsing and Yahoo Messenger through 'Blackberry'. However, everything else, (not through 'Blackberry'), will cost you £1 per Mb

Quote:
Originally Posted by Dawg View Post
Wouldnt Opera be web browsing?
It would, but my understanding is that as it goes through the providers data connection rather than through 'Blackberry', it is not covered within the tariff - ie use the 'Blackberry' browser (ugh!) and it's included, use anything else and it isn't. Of course we pay OTT for everything in the UK!
